How Common Is The Last Name Drydon? popularity and diffusion
The surname is the 4,649,889th most commonly used family name at a global level It is held by approximately 1 in 404,863,662 people. The surname occurs predominantly in Europe, where 83 percent of Drydon are found; 83 percent are found in Northern Europe and 83 percent are found in British Isles.
This surname is most commonly occurring in England, where it is held by 14 people, or 1 in 3,979,861. In England it is most numerous in: Northumberland, where 64 percent reside, Hertfordshire, where 7 percent reside and East Sussex, where 7 percent reside. Beside England Drydon is found in 3 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 11 percent reside and Jamaica, where 6 percent reside.
Drydon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Drydon has changed through the years. In England the number of people bearing the Drydon last name contracted 79 percent between 1881 and 2014; in The United States it contracted 96 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in Scotland it contracted 67 percent between 1881 and 2014.
